Diesel Maintenance for FLPosted November 15, 2020 7:25 AMAt Key Auto Hospital we hear from a lot of people who are excited about the new diesel engines that will soon be available in passenger cars and SUV's. But our FL friends are often curious about the preventive maintenance requirements. People may not know that diesel engines have long been used extensively in Europe and Asia. In fact, in some markets, there're nearly as many diesel powered passenger cars as there are gasoline. Key Auto Hospital | ||
